Description
The sd_bus_reply_method_error() function sends an error reply to the call message. The error structure e
specifies the error to send, and is used as described in sd_bus_message_new_method_error(3). If no reply
is expected to call, this function succeeds without sending a reply.
The sd_bus_reply_method_errorf() is to sd_bus_reply_method_error() what
sd_bus_message_new_method_errorf() is to sd_bus_message_new_method_error().
The sd_bus_reply_method_errno() is to sd_bus_reply_method_error() what sd_bus_message_new_method_errno()
is to sd_bus_message_new_method_error().
The sd_bus_reply_method_errnof() is to sd_bus_reply_method_error() what
sd_bus_message_new_method_errnof() is to sd_bus_message_new_method_error().
Name
sd_bus_reply_method_error, sd_bus_reply_method_errorf, sd_bus_reply_method_errorfv,
sd_bus_reply_method_errno, sd_bus_reply_method_errnof, sd_bus_reply_method_errnofv - Reply with an error
to a D-Bus method call
Notes
Functions described here are available as a shared library, which can be compiled against and linked to
with the libsystemdpkg-config(1) file.
The code described here uses getenv(3), which is declared to be not multi-thread-safe. This means that
the code calling the functions described here must not call setenv(3) from a parallel thread. It is
recommended to only do calls to setenv() from an early phase of the program when no other threads have
been started.
Return Value
This function returns a non-negative integer if the error reply was successfully sent or if call does not
expect a reply. On failure, it returns a negative errno-style error code.
Errors
Returned errors may indicate the following problems:
-EINVAL
The input parameter call is NULL.
Message call is not a method call message.
Message call is not attached to a bus.
The error parameter e to sd_bus_reply_method_error() is not set, see sd_bus_error_is_set(3).
-EPERM
Message call has been sealed.
-ENOTCONN
The bus to which message call is attached is not connected.
-ENOMEM
Memory allocation failed.
In addition, any error returned by sd_bus_send(3) may be returned.
